RTP and Volatility Profiles
One of the biggest selling points for seeking out Spigo slot sites is the Return to Player percentages. Many of their games hover around the 96% to 97% mark, which is comfortably above the industry average. For example, their classic titles often feature RTPs that rival top-tier table games. This makes them ideal for clearing bonuses. If you have a 15x wagering requirement on a BetMGM bonus, playing a Spigo slot with 97% RTP is mathematically better than playing a 94% RTP licensed slot from other major studios. You aren't guaranteed a win, but you are minimizing the 'house edge' tax on every spin.

State Availability and Legal Considerations
You can’t just sign up anywhere. The US iGaming landscape is a patchwork of state regulations. New Jersey, Pennsylvania, Michigan, West Virginia, and Connecticut are the primary hubs where you’ll find a robust selection of online slots. If you are in New York or California, you won’t find real-money versions of these games at licensed operators. Instead, you might encounter Spigo titles at social casinos that use a 'Gold Coins' and 'Sweeps Coins' model. This distinction is crucial: real money casinos require KYC verification and offer direct cash withdrawals, while social casinos offer prize redemption.

Do Spigo slots have high RTP?
Generally, yes. Spigo is known for competitive Return to Player percentages, often ranging between 96% and 97%. This is higher than many land-based slots (which often sit around 88-90%) and competitive with top-tier online slots, giving players a slightly better theoretical return over time.
